The past simple tense (sometimes called preterite, simple past or past indefinite) is the basic form of the past tense. This is one of the most common past tenses and can describe a lot of events. It is really important to know how and when to use this tense for daily conversation. But there are a lot of irregular past tense forms in English.

Pronunciation: ·The past tense of fall. The boy fell out of the tree and broke his arm.··If you fell something, you make it fall. He felled the tree by chopping it down with an axe.

Falling is the present participle: The sound of rain falling is calming for many people. 4. Fell is the simple past: One of the kids fell into the river. 5. Will fall is the future tense: The bench will fall and break if anyone else sits on it. 6. Fallen is the past participle: The handle had fallen off the drawer. ‍.

What is the past tense of "fall?". Most commonly, the past tense of the word "fall" is "fell" although the word form will change based on its participle. And the sentence where it's used. For example, referencing "fall" in the past participle form will change it to "fallen," but in the infinitive form, will be "fall.".
